Taliban Targets Afghanistan Peace Jirga -- L.A. Times

In a rejection of reconciliation efforts, Taliban sends three militants to disrupt President Hamid Karzai's meeting with tribal elders. Two attackers are killed and one is arrested.

Reporting from Kabul, Afghanistan — As Afghan President Hamid Karzai pitched the idea of peace talks with the Taliban to a large tribal gathering Wednesday in the capital, burka-clad suicide-bomb attackers armed with rocket grenade launchers tried to breach the assembly's heavily fortified compound in an ominous rebuke from the insurgency to his bid for reconciliation.
